Black Tiger IV, next generation of Dynamite Kid to battle Tiger Mask in final matches
After a 31 year career, the fourth generation of Tiger Mask will call it a career on July 7. His retirement card on Korakuen Hall will see a tribute to not only his own career, but the history of Tiger mask at large, and Tiger Mask IV will be doing double duty on the evening.

While Magnus has taken the mantle of the ninth and latest Black Tiger in CMLL, it is with the fourth iteration of the nefarious masked man that Tiger Mask IV has the deepest connection to. A heated rivalry through the mid 2000s would flare up again in 2009, ending in a Ryogoku Hall IWGP Junior Heavyweight title versus mask match. Black Tiger would lose the apuestas bout and reveal himself as Rocky Romero; now 17 years on, Rocky will don the mask for one night only to take on the old enemy one more time.
While Tiger Mask versus Black Tiger is a feud that goes beyond the ring and into the original Tiger Mask anime and manga, in NJPW and around the world, one rivalry has defined the Tiger Mask legend throughout the generations. On April 23 1981, Satoru Sayama made his first appearance as the original Tiger Mask, facing British great the Dynamite Kid, and the feud between the two men, ever escalating as Dynamite tried and tried again to beat his nemesis entranced fans everywhere from Kuramae in Tokyo to Madison Square Garden in New York. Now, 45 years on, Tiger Mask versus Dynamite Kid is at the top of a billing once more, as the 24 year old nephew of the original Dynamite, Tommy Billington takes on the fourth Tiger Mask on this special night.
